Output 95ef0518d67143e696f878380d0e1593aba892d01dcfb63628214effa8f2e457: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8cb1fe544219aae07f646eaef8b69153d885a34 OP_EQUALVERIFY OP_CHECKSIG
address
1LmJHnD5LKrFn2LYjLGgTMuDJLVkvM276B
transaction
95ef0518d67143e696f878380d0e1593aba892d01dcfb63628214effa8f2e457
confirmations
573557
spent
true